Last night, the West Branch girls volleyball team secured a hard-fought victory against their rivals from Salem, emerging with a 3-0 win.
Scores:
- Set 1: 25-20
- Set 2: 25-21
- Set 3: 25-17
Junior Kendyll Kaley was a key player, leading from the service line with 10 points and one ace. Her performance was rounded out with 6 kills, an assist, 3 digs, and 4 assisted blocks.
Setters Isabel Martig and Josie Milliken both contributed significantly, each serving 8 points. Martig notched 16 assists and 8 digs, while Milliken added 13 assists and 8 digs.
On the offensive front, Audrey Ring and Abigail Janosik each recorded 9 kills and 3 assisted blocks. Ring also had 10 digs, with Jasonik contributing 2.
What's Next: With the win, the Warriors have now won five straight matches and hold a strong record of 9-3 overall and 4-1 in the EBC. They will be back in action on Thursday at Minerva, with the JV match starting at 5:30 PM and the Varsity match at 6:30 PM.
